SETHANI KA JOHARA
Sethani Ka Johara lies on the north roadside maybe 5 km west of Churu along the Ratangarh street. It is maybe the best Johara (repository) in the zone in that it isn't just alluring yet in addition effective, holding a store of water, regularly starting with one rainstorm then onto the next. It was worked in 1899 by the widow of Bhagwan Das Bagla as a major aspect of the starvation help extends that the shippers financed in those horrible long periods of the end of the century. Aath Kambh Chhatri, one of the structures having incredible recorded importance, is an eight pillared arch that remains on the northern side of the town. Lying between the premises bordering the western side of the vegetable market, the chhatri is accepted to be developed in 1776. Throughout the years, the windblown sand has basically covered the base of the structure, while the insides are as yet decorated with lovely wall paintings and stone cut works of art.RATANGARH FORT

Prestigious for being a place of refuge blackbuck and an assortment of feathered creatures, this asylum is named after the Chhapar town. Situated in the Sujangarh Tehsil of Churu, it is 210 km from Jaipur. Its open fields dissipated with trees give it the presence of a savannah. The haven is a feathered creature watcher's heaven as it is home to winged animals, for example, eastern royal bird, dark ibis, demoiselle cranes, skylarks, ring pigeons and that's just the beginning. One can likewise detect the desert fox and desert feline here.LAXMANGARH FORT
